MARIOLA JABŁOŃSKA, PhD, DSc, Assoc. Prof.

DIRECTOR OF THE UNIVERSITY LABORATORIES
FOR ATMOSPHERE CONTROL

e-mail: mariola.jablonska@us.edu.pl

Co-organiser of the first Polish Overhead Mobile Laboratory placed in the basket of a manned hot-air balloon for interdisciplinary research on atmospheric pollution. Currently the Director of the University Laboratories for Atmosphere Control (ULAC).

Responsible for equipping the laboratory with equipment that enables conducting interdisciplinary research of the atmosphere.

She conducts studies of mineral, phase and chemical composition of particulates in the atmosphere.

Research interests:

research in the field of environmental and medical mineralogy, with a particular focus on the mineralogy of particulates in the human pulmonary tissue. Research in the field of geochemistry and environmental mineralogy using SEM and TEM electron microscopy methods.

STANISŁAW DUBER, PhD, DSc, Assoc. Prof.

Faculty of Natural Sciences

e-mail: stanislaw.duber@us.edu.pl

He conducts research in the fields of physics and environmental physics. He focuses on the analysis of particulate pollutants using an XRF spectrometer.

He conducts studies on the structure of different forms of natural coal (hard coal, anthracite and graphite), as well as synthetic coal materials (active carbon, glassy carbon, carbon foam, carbon nanotubes), including examination of the structure of technical soot and soot in the atmosphere.

The scientific activity also includes research commissioned by the carbon and graphite material industry.

Prof. JANUSZ JANECZEK

Faculty of Natural Sciences

e-mail: janusz.janeczek@us.edu.pl

A co-organiser of the first Polish Overhead Mobile Laboratory placed in the basket of a manned hot-air balloon for interdisciplinary research on atmospheric pollution.

He conducts research on the mineral and phase composition of atmospheric particulate pollutants and their spatial dispersion, including the identification of sources of atmospheric pollution and the role of air particulates in the mineralisation of human lungs.

He has conducted mineralogical and geochemical research on natural nuclear reactors with a particular focus on uranium minerals and the migration of radioactive elements.

He focuses on different problems of mineralogy, including environmental mineralogy.

PIOTR SIUPKA, PhD

Faculty of Natural Sciences

e-mail: piotr.siupka@us.edu.pl

A biologist and microbiologist. He conducts research ranging from microbiological characteristics of hard coal environments, through mechanisms of adaptation of microorganisms for life in such environments, to determination of the potential of using microorganisms from such environments.

He was the first person in Poland to use a μCoriolis air particle sampler for collecting microbiological samples in the air using an overhead mobile laboratory placed in a manned hot-air balloon.

Interests:

  • microbiology of environments related to hard coal
  • microorganisms in air pollutants and their migration in the environment,
  • use of microbiology in new technologies,
  • discovering new bacteria strains and the possibility of their practical application (e.g., the discovery of a new strain of actinobacteria in soot).
